Step 1: Online Banking Registration

Before you can check your ATM card balance online, please ensure you have registered for online banking with your bank. Most banks provide online banking services to their customers, allowing them to access their accounts securely over the Internet.

  • Visit your bank’s official website.
  • Look for the “Online Banking” or “Internet Banking” section.
  • Follow the registration process by providing the required information, such as your account number, ATM card details, and personal information.
  • Create a strong and secure password for your online banking account.

Step 2: Logging into Your Online Banking Account

Once you have successfully registered for online banking, log in to your account using the credentials you created during the registration process.

  • Visit your bank’s official website.
  • Locate the “Login” or “Sign In” option on the homepage.
  • Enter your username and password.
  • Some banks may also require additional authentication methods, such as OTP (One-Time Password) sent to your registered mobile number.

Step 3: Accessing Your Account Information

After logging in, navigate to the section that allows you to view your account information. This is typically labeled as “Account Summary” or “Account Overview.”

Look for an option like “View Balance” or “Account Balance.”

Step 4: Checking Your ATM Card Balance

Once you are in the account information section, you should be able to see your current account balance, including details related to your ATM card transactions.

  • Locate the section that displays your available balance or current balance.
  • Some banks may also provide an option to view a detailed transaction history, including recent ATM transactions.

Step 5: Mobile Banking Apps

Apart from online banking, many banks also offer mobile banking apps for added convenience. Follow these steps to check your ATM card balance using a mobile banking app:

  • Download and install your bank’s official mobile banking app from the App Store (for iOS devices) or Google Play Store (for Android devices).
  • Log in to the app using your online banking credentials.
  • Navigate to the “Account Summary” or “Balance” section to view your ATM card balance.

Is Account Balance and Available Balance the Same?

No. The whole amount of money in your account, including any pending transactions, fixed deposits, and recurring deposits, is called your account balance.

The amount you can spend, or your debit card balance if it’s connected to the same account, is known as the available balance.
